Medical Industry MBA - China Admissions

The Medical Industry MBA program consists of 21 courses offered in 3-day modules once a month. First and second semesters provide students with the core curriculum of the MBA program, facilitating an in-depth examination of the functions of the organization. Courses in the third and fourth semesters are designed to expand on complex management challenges and the larger context of the global medical industry.

Admission Checklist

To complete your University of Minnesota application for the Medical Industry MBA program, you will need the following materials:

Complete the application online. 

You will need to submit a transcript from each college or university where you have completed coursework before your application will be considered complete and reviewed by the admissions committee.

Official transcripts will be required if you are admitted to the program.

Your personal statement should be no more than 1200 words (3 pages), and addresses one of the following questions:

  • Based on your experience in the field, what do you think the products of the medical technology industry will be in ten years, and what will your role be in that industry?
     
  • How do you plan on making an impact in the medical industry?
  • The video essay is a required component of the application that provides candidates with an opportunity to show the admissions committee the authentic you.  Think of this video essay as if you were answering an interview question with a member of our admissions committee. 
  • You will need to use a computer with camera and microphone capabilities. You will also need a strong internet connection for uploading the video. You will have the ability to test your technology before starting the video essay and submit a practice video essay. 
  • You can test your technology and run the practice simulation as many times as you wish to be comfortable with the format and technology.  You will be able to review your practice video essay(s) and your recording(s) will not be saved beyond the testing phase and will never be reviewed.
  • You can also practice responding to impromptu questions offline with a friend or colleague before completing the video essay portion of your application.
  • You will be prompted to click "Ready" once you are prepared to submit an official video essay.  You will be asked one impromptu question from a bank of imaginative or behavioral questions selected by our admissions team. 
  • Two minutes (120 seconds) will be provided to prepare an answer and two minutes (120 seconds) to record an answer.  The recording will automatically stop after two minutes.  You are not required to use the full two minutes.  If you have time remaining once complete with your response, click the "Stop Recording" button to end the recording. 
  • You will only be provided one attempt to record your official video essay.

Submit a current resume (CV) that includes job responsibilities, accomplishments, and demonstrates 3-5 years of full-time experience.

Medical Industry MBA Tuition

The total tuition fee for the program is RMB 408,000, of which RMB 204,000 is due to the University of Minnesota, and RMB 204,000 is due to our academic services partner, Joint-Share. The Joint-Share portion of tuition will be due in full upon your acceptance of admission to the program. The University of Minnesota portion can be paid through the following. 

  • Pay 50% of the University of Minnesota portion in September of the first program year with the RMB/USD exchange rate as of August 1st of the entering year
  • Pay 50% of the University of Minnesota portion in the second program year with the RMB/USD exchange rate as of August 1st of the second year
